Cannabis in Microdoses Improves Non-Motor Symptoms of Parkinson's, Brazilian Study Indicates in Six Patients

The study had few patients and did not use a placebo-controlled group, but it was conducted on humans and the results suggest possible benefits of cannabis against the disease in non-motor symptoms.

A recent Brazilian study published in Frontiers revealed that the use of microdoses of cannabis may alleviate non-motor symptoms of Parkinson's disease, such as cognitive and sleep disturbances. The research analyzed six patients who used low doses of cannabis oil and showed promising results in sleep quality. Additionally, the participants did not report adverse side effects, indicating a potentially favorable safety profile.

 

Small Doses, Big Effects

 

The study participants self-administered 0.5 mL of cannabis extract for 90 days. They were divided into two groups: one used the extract containing 250 micrograms of THC, and the other used the extract containing 1000 micrograms of THC, both with higher proportions of THC than CBD. The researchers observed that even in minimal amounts, THC showed therapeutic potential, positively impacting the patients' well-being without causing adverse effects.

Another relevant point was the patients' response to the microdoses. The researchers identified that the beneficial effects occurred without cognitive impairment or significant changes in the participants' perception. This suggests that small amounts of THC may be a viable option for managing non-motor symptoms in Parkinson's.

 

Mechanisms of Cannabidiol in Parkinson's

 

An Australian randomized clinical trial had also identified that THC can enhance patients' mood and sleep, providing a more comprehensive approach to treating the disease. Previous studies have indicated that the endocannabinoid system plays a crucial role in regulating processes such as inflammation and neuroprotection, reinforcing the therapeutic potential of cannabis in Parkinson's.

Furthermore, the researchers highlight that the effects of CBD seem to be linked to its ability to modulate neurotransmitters like dopamine and serotonin, which are essential in motor and emotional control. This suggests that the compound may have positive impacts on both the classic symptoms of the disease and psychological aspects, such as anxiety and depression, that affect many patients.

 

What to Expect in the Future?

 

Despite the promising advances, experts emphasize that more studies with larger samples are needed to validate the efficacy and safety of cannabis use in treating Parkinson's. For those interested in treatment, the recommendation is to seek guidance from specialized health professionals to evaluate the best approach according to each case. Scientists also stress that more research is essential to determine the ideal dosage and specific mechanisms of action of cannabinoids in Parkinson's.

Another important point is the need for regulation and safe access to cannabis-based products. While some countries already allow the medicinal use of the plant for neurodegenerative diseases, in others, regulatory barriers still hinder the adoption of this therapeutic alternative. With the advancement of research, it is hoped that new guidelines can expand treatment options for patients with Parkinson's and other neurological conditions.
